My Approach to Helping
I'm an artist and therapist. As an artist, I work in different types of media. I have found art to be healing. I have two cats and a dog who bring me a lot of joy. I work with people of all gender identities, age 13 and up. I have a Person-Centered approach to therapy. I believe that you have the power to achieve a healthy and balanced life; my role as a therapist is to help you process through this journey. I specialize in anxiety, depression, and substance abuse. I have worked in Treatment Centers as well as Private Practice. I have a strong background working with people who have anxiety and depression as well as ADHD. Being 11 years sober is one of the reasons that pushed me to develop expertise in substance abuse treatment. I work with alcoholics and addicts wanting to improve their lives as well as families who have loved ones struggling with substance abuse. I offer online and in-person counseling. I work hard to create a safe, comfortable space for my clients in my office. There is a comfortable seating area for one-on-one sessions. There is also an art area for those who find it easier to open up while working on a creative project, but I never push art on my clients as it is not a good fit for everyone. I create a safe space online by using a HIPAA-compliant platform. Additionally, I have a designated room in my home where I conduct sessions, which provides complete privacy. My goal is to provide you with a space where you won't feel judged and you will feel heard.
